蛋白质的另一秘密

           我们已经知道了,蛋白质是对生物体生命的形成起着决定性的作用,而且在生命这架复杂的“机器”的正常运转中也起着至关重要的作用。但是蛋白质的用途却远不止于此,它的另一秘密就是它还在人类的工农业生产和医药生产有着广泛而重要的用途。
  我们知道,动物的丝、毛(内含角质蛋白)是纺织工业的重要原料,而牛皮、猪皮、羊皮经鞣制后可成为柔软、富有弹性的皮革。今天我们身上穿的羊毛,驼绒的衣服,脚上穿的锃亮柔软的皮鞋说起来都是蛋白质的功劳呢!还有动物胶也是蛋白质,它是用动物的皮和骨熬制成的,广泛用作木材的胶粘剂。无色透明的动物胶叫做白明胶,它是制造电影胶片、照相底片的主要原材料。蛋白质在生物医学上的运用就更多了,由蛋白质制成的各种生物制剂如氨基酸、胎盘球蛋白、血清蛋白、水解蛋白和酶(如胰蛋白酶、胃蛋白酶)等都是重要的医药原料。蛋白质还可制取蛋白粘胶纤维。下面我们简单介绍一下一些蛋白生物制剂的作用。
  猪毛是一种重要的加工原料,它是一种角质蛋白质,不溶于水,但能被酸、碱等分解,生成胱氨酸和其它多种氨基酸。
  猪毛+浓盐酸胱氨酸+其它氨基酸
  现在,人们已很重视对猪毛、人发的收集,用它来制取胱氨酸等产品。制得的胱氨酸有促进机体细胞氧化和还原的功能,以及增加白血球和阻止病原菌发育等作用。它在医疗制药中被广泛用于治疗各种脱发症,也用于痢疾、伤寒、流感等急性传染病,以及气喘、神经痛、湿疹和各种中毒疾患等。
  蛋白质生物制剂是今天医学上有着重要用途的药剂。现在有大量的口服水解蛋白就是属于这一类。口服水解蛋白含有各种人体所必需的各种氨基酸,它能在肠道中被直接吸收,对于缺乏蛋白质所引起的肌体消耗和机能不全的患者能迅速有效地得到氨基酸补充。在临床医学中被广泛用于治疗营养不良、重病后体亏、妊娠及产后虚弱等。水解蛋白主要以动物的血纤维(也可用鸡毛、鸭毛等)为原料来制取。
  蛋白生物制剂的重要的另外一类是蛋白酶的制取,如胰蛋白酶。酶是一种高效的生物催化剂,不同的酶具有不同的作用,如蛋白酶只能催化蛋白质的分解反应,不能催化淀粉的分解反应。由于酶是蛋白质,因此易受温度和PH的影响,人体中的大多数酶,在37℃左右和近乎中性的环境下具有最大的作用。人类目前已发现的酶有一千多种,胰蛋白酶就是其中的一种,它主要存在于高等动物的胰脏中,能消化蛋白质,在医药上用于制取消化药(它主要从牛、猪、羊的胰脏中提取)。
  现代医学的发展已经从蛋白质及蛋白生物制剂的发展中看到了前景,现代基因技术以及分子生物学的发展必将为人类带来一个健康的未来。
